896517403320 has 128 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 3353207984640. Its totient is φ = 186289328640.
The previous prime is 896517403307. The next prime is 896517403333. The reversal of 896517403320 is 23304715698.
It is an interprime number because it is at equal distance from previous prime (896517403307) and next prime (896517403333).
It is a self number, because there is not a number n which added to its sum of digits gives 896517403320.
It is a congruent number.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 31 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 48503607 + ... + 48522086.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(26196937380).
It is a 1-persistent number, because it is pandigital, but 2⋅896517403320 = 1793034806640 is not.
Almost surely, 2896517403320 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
896517403320 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(2456690581320).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
896517403320 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
896517403320 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 97025725 (or 97025721 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 1088640, while the sum is 48.
The spelling of 896517403320 in words is "eight hundred ninety-six billion, five hundred seventeen million, four hundred three thousand, three hundred twenty".
